Young man drowns in Murrumbidgee River at Uriarra Crossing

A 23-year-old man has drowned following an incident at the Murrumbidgee River earlier today, Thursday 8 February.       

About 5.40pm, police and emergency services responded to reports that a man had gone into the water near the Uriarra Crossing bridge and failed to surface.    

A search for the man was commenced, utilising resources from ACT Policing, AFP Search and Rescue, ACT Fire & Rescue, and the SES.    

Sadly, the man’s body was located in the water about 8.35pm.    

ACT Policing will prepare a report for the Coroner.   

Anyone who witnessed the incident who has not already spoken to police is urged to contact ACT Policing on 131 444. Please quote reference 7668984.
